Vigan Longganisa Festival 2026 opened on January 15 in Vigan City, Ilocos Sur, as a major part of the annual city fiesta. Local leaders announced events, contests, and tourism plans, including a popularity contest and preparations to support tourism and local business during the festival period. The celebration marked years of Vigan’s food and culture tradition tied to its garlic longganisa, a key local product under the One Town One Product program.




The festival included a longganisa cookfest where chefs, students, and hospitality groups presented creative dishes using the iconic sausage in soups, appetizers, and desserts. Students from STI College Vigan won senior high categories with menus featuring longganisa innovations. The festival also included trade exhibits of local products and events honoring farmers and fishers whose produce supports the city’s food culture.  

Visitors experienced street activities, cultural displays, and food tasting across Vigan. The event drew attention to local food heritage and its economic impact on tourism. Longganisa creations attracted food lovers and encouraged future chefs to explore regional cuisine. The festival strengthened Vigan’s reputation as a culinary destination during the January citywide fiesta.
